►►Divisional Championships S18 registration
Registration is now open for the Divisional Championships
The link to the registration list is here
18th season of the FISO Divisional Championships
Premiership, Championship, League 1, League 2, National league and Sunday league.
7 rounds of 5 game weeks, with promotion and relegation at the end of each round.
Rules.
All that is required to play is to be a FISO member and have a valid FPL id.
Multiple team entries from an individual will not be allowed.
Registration is open all season and new players are more than welcome.
New players will be added to the Sunday league at the start of the next round.
Scoring
Traditional FPL scoring, the data for the GW points is taken directly from the FPL website for each manager. The cost of hits will not count in the first GW of each round but in the other four GW's hit costs will be deducted from the GW score.
TIEBREAKERS
1. Fewest Transfers in the Round.
2. H2H wins for each GW in the Round between the tied teams 1 point for a GW win 0 points for a loss or draw.
TC from GW1 get deducted only for the H2H tiebreaker purpose.
3. Overall FPL points for the whole FPL season to date.
4. Admins decision will be the final tie breaker but the manager having a lower FPL ID is not too bad if it gets to this point, and better than a virtual coin toss.
